Framingham, Massachusetts: Old America Company, Publishers, 1924. First Edition. Cloth. Fine/very good +. Wallace Nutting. SIGNED. FIRST EDITION. 4to; 302pp; dark olive cloth over board, title gilt-stamped on front, blind-stamped borders and label; author's signature on ffep dated "30 Sept, 1924"; pictorial vignette to title-page; 72 plates with photographic illustrations; b&w drawings in text; unclipped pictorial dust jacket without price, light damp staining to fore-edges, closed tear at foot of spine at front joint; fine in very good plus dj. Wallace Nutting (1861-1941) was a New England Congregational minister and noted photographer and artist. He bicycled for his health and it was on these rides that he embarked on his lifelong quest to photograph his magnificent and historic New England surroundings. Maine Beautiful is a print and photographic love affair with the state of Maine.
